Intrinsic conscious experiences—thoughts, daydreams, and mind-wandering—make up as much as half of conscious life but are largely ignored in consciousness research because they are methodologically difficult and lack dedicated experimental paradigms. This hypothesis and theory article proposes a new paradigm for studying intrinsic consciousness, modeled on methods used for perceptual consciousness. The authors present exploratory proof-of-concept data, discuss how the paradigm could be used, and address its limitations and possible solutions. They argue that intrinsic consciousness will soon become a standard topic in consciousness studies once suitable experimental tools are developed.

Personality traits, particularly the dimension of self-transcendence measured by Cloninger's Temperament and Character Inventory, correlate with people's intuitive inclinations toward either dualism or reductive materialism regarding the mind-body problem. In a pilot study using a newly developed questionnaire based on analytic philosophy of the mind, participants categorized as dualists showed significant differences in self-transcendence scores compared to those categorized as reductive materialists. The findings suggest that philosophical positions on the mind-body problem, and possibly responses to thought experiments in philosophy of mind, may be influenced by underlying personality features, a factor that should be considered in future philosophical and empirical research.

The science of consciousness has largely relied on identifying neural correlates of conscious experience, but this approach has not yet yielded a mechanistic understanding. Advances in brain stimulation techniques, such as geodesic transcranial electric neuromodulation, now make it possible to move beyond correlation and toward causal explanations. By directly altering neural activity, researchers can test hypotheses about the mechanisms that generate conscious states, overcoming the limitations of purely observational methods. This shift promises to advance the empirical study of consciousness.

This review addresses two central questions about consciousness: the 'how' (neural correlates and mechanisms) and the 'why' (the hard problem of why conscious experience exists at all). The authors argue that while the hard problem will likely never fully disappear, its significance may diminish as empirical research advances. They predict that future work will be guided by a unifying brain theory—predictive coding—which must explain both perceptual consciousness and conscious mind-wandering to succeed. Such a theory could clarify the function of conscious experience, thereby reducing the weight of the hard problem.
